Improving search efficiency for systematic reviews of diagnostic test accuracy:
an exploratory study to assess the viability of limiting to MEDLINE, EMBASE and
reference checking

BACKGROUND: Increasing numbers of systematic reviews evaluating the diagnostic
test accuracy of technologies are being published. Currently, review teams tend
to apply conventional systematic review standards to identify relevant studies
for inclusion, for example sensitive searches of multiple bibliographic
databases. There has been little evaluation of the efficiency of searching only
one or two such databases for this type of review. The aim of this study was to
assess the viability of an approach that restricted searches to MEDLINE, EMBASE
and the reference lists of included studies. METHODS: A convenience sample of
nine Health Technology Assessment (HTA) systematic reviews of diagnostic test
accuracy, with 302 included citations, was analysed to determine the number and
proportion of included citations that were indexed in and retrieved from MEDLINE
and EMBASE. An assessment was also made of the number and proportion of citations
not retrieved from these databases but that could have been identified from the
reference lists of included citations. RESULTS: 287/302 (95 %) of the included
citations in the nine reviews were indexed across MEDLINE and EMBASE. The
reviews' searches of MEDLINE and EMBASE accounted for 85 % of the included
citations (256/302). Of the forty-six (15 %) included citations not retrieved by
the published searches, 24 (8 %) could be found in the reference lists of
included citations. Only 22/302 (7 %) of the included citations were not found by
the proposed, more efficient approach. CONCLUSIONS: The proposed approach would
have accounted for 280/302 (93 %) of included citations in this sample of nine
systematic reviews. This exploratory study suggests that there might be a case
for restricting searches for systematic reviews of diagnostic test accuracy
studies to MEDLINE, EMBASE and the reference lists of included citations. The
conduct of such reviews might be rendered more efficient by using this approach.
